Crashfall ingests crash reports from the Lumenote mobile apps and symbolicates them before indexing. There are three environments: dev, staging, and prod. Only prod receives live app traffic; staging replays a sampled feed with a two-hour delay. If you're on call and ingestion lags, check the symbolication queue depth first — it's the usual bottleneck. Dev symbol stores are wiped nightly, so missing symbols there are expected. The prod environment's current configuration values are listed below for quick reference.

settings of yafog-kagep:
NOVVAN_PIN=8841
NOVVAN_TENANT=pelwyn
NOVVAN_METRICS_HOST=metrics.novvan.orvexforge.example
NOVVAN_SEAL=seal_30060f3e
NOVVAN_STANDBY_TEAM=wenox

/*
 * Cron drift investigation (INC-2291): the Tideholm scheduler nodes
 * drifted ~40s after the NTP peer change, so job timestamps in the
 * audit log look skewed. This client queries the internal clock-sync
 * service to compare reported vs. actual fire times. If paged,
 * run the drift report first. Authenticate with the key below.
 */

gateway credential: kto3_qfe

## Local Setup

The Kestrelgate rate limiter enforces per-tenant token buckets at the edge of our internal API mesh. For local review, run the gateway with `kestrelgate serve --dev`, which disables upstream auth but keeps limit enforcement active so you can verify bucket behavior. Counters and tenant quotas are persisted rather than held in memory. Configure the limiter's persistence layer with the connection string below.

primary connection of yagep-kahip = redis://giliel_svc:zYiKsLL2PLpfPL@db-348f.xolmarsys.corp:5432/fenwyn

## Support

The extraction of the user module from the Cobblewick monolith is tracked under the Strand initiative. Release managers should note that both the legacy endpoints and the new Userhive service run in parallel until cutover; any release touching authentication must be flagged for dual verification. Rollback procedures are documented in the Strand playbook, revision four. For cutover scheduling questions or blocking defects, contact the platform stewardship group at the address below.

billing contact of yawip-yadup = druath.casdor@nelvrolabs.internal